Narsee Monjee Institute of Management Studies (NMIMS), Mumbai, established in 1981 and managed by the SVKM, is a deemed-to-be university recognised for its excellence in management, engineering, law, pharmacy, and other disciplines. NMIMS offers flagship MBA programs along with B.Tech, BBA, LLB, LLM, M.Sc, PhD, and integrated courses through its 17 specialised schools. Admissions are contingent upon passing specific entrance examinations, including NMAT, NPAT, NMIMS CET, NMIMS LAT, and JEE Main for engineering programs. The fees of the MBA course range from INR 6.5 lakhs to 12.5 lakhs in the first year, and the B.Tech course costs INR 3.5 lakhs. It has powerful industry connections, with major recruiters such as EY, Amazon, Google, McKinsey, and Goldman Sachs offering the highest packages of INR 67.7 LPA. The campus provides comprehensive facilities that foster innovation, diversity, and global exposure. NMIMS consistently ranks among India’s top institutes in the NIRF, IIRF, Outlook, and India Today rankings.

SVKM NMIMS Admission 2025
Admission to NMIMS Mumbai is entrance-based and varies by program. For the flagship MBA programs, candidates must appear for the NMAT by GMAC, followed by further rounds, including the Writing Ability Test (WAT), Competency-Based Assessment, and Personal Interview (PI). For UG courses like BBA and B.Tech, admissions are through NPAT and NMIMS-CET, respectively. The entire application process is conducted online via the official NMIMS admission portal.
SVKM NMIMS Placements 2025
Narsee Monjee Institute of Management Studies (NMIMS), Mumbai, also boasts a highly mature placement cell that aims to secure top-level positions for students in various industries. The university's strong corporate ties and substantial alumni network have led to stable placement opportunities. The maximum salary package in 2024 was very competitive at INR 67.7 LPA, and the average salary package was INR 25.13 LPA (for MBA core). To promote preparedness among students, NMIMS maintains a regular system of pre-placement activities, including resume-building sessions, aptitude training, case studies, workshops, mock interviews, and corporate guest lecture programs. Each year, a diverse range of recruiters from consulting, finance, technology, FMCG, and e-commerce sectors are involved.
SVKM NMIMS Cutoffs 2025
Narsee Monjee Institute of Management Studies (NMIMS), Mumbai uses NMAT by GMAC scores for admission to its MBA programs. For the General category, the expected NMAT 2024 cutoff for top MBA programs ranges from 205 to 250. Programs such as MBA Core and MBA HR have the highest expected cutoffs, with section-wise cutoffs also taken into consideration for final shortlisting. NMIMS assigns 70% weightage to NMAT scores, with the remaining 30% based on WAT, competency-based assessments, and interviews.
SVKM NMIMS Ranking 2025
Narsee Monjee Institute of Management Studies (NMIMS), Mumbai, holds a strong reputation among India’s top private universities and management institutes. NMIMS ranks 5th in India among all MBA colleges, as judged by the parameters of academic excellence, global partnerships, and industry-relevant curriculum, as suggested in the India International Ranking Framework (IIRF) 2025. The institute is well represented in various national rankings, including NIRF and Outlook.

What is the criteria of admissions into MBA programs at NMIMS Mumbai?
The candidates should have a degree at the baccalaureate level acquired with a 50 percent or more marks. It is mostly through the NMAT by GMAC score, after which there is the WAT, Competency-Based Assessment and Personal Interview.
What will be the tentative NMAT 2024 cut off of NMIMS Mumbai MBA?
The overall NMAT expected cutoff by candidates in general category is 205-250 marks. In case of the best courses such as MBA Core or HR the cutoffs would surpass 232 with sectional cutups in Logical Reasoning (71), Language Skills (76) and Quantitative Skills (69).
How is the admission process conducted at NMIMS Mumbai?
The admission process includes online registration at the NMAT and NMIMS portals, uploading documents, submission of NMAT scores, and participation in WAT, Competency Assessment, and PI rounds. Final admission is based on a composite merit list.
What is the fee structure for MBA programs at NMIMS Mumbai?
The first-year MBA fees range between INR 6.5 lakh to INR 12.5 lakh, depending on the specialization. The programs typically run for 2 years.
How is NMIMS Mumbai ranked nationally?
As per the IIRF 2025, NMIMS Mumbai is ranked 5th among MBA colleges in India. It is also ranked 21st by NIRF 2024 (MBA category) and 3rd overall by Outlook 2025.
